Microsoft Designer Review & Benchmarks
Microsoft's consumer generative design and slide studio powered by DALL-E 3 and OpenAI models.
Overview & System Architecture
Microsoft Designer brings generative AI to consumer graphics and presentations, generating custom illustrated slides, social banners, and invitations from text prompts.

Total Value & Pricing Assessment
Currently free with a personal Microsoft account (integrated into Copilot Pro).
| Plan | Price | Billing Terms | Key Inclusions |
|---|---|---|---|
| Free | $0 | forever | DALL-E 3 visual creation · Automated slide designs · Export to PowerPoint |
Strengths & Trade-Offs
Strengths
- Completely free with a Microsoft account
- Direct export to Microsoft PowerPoint
- DALL-E 3 custom illustrations included
Trade-Offs & Limitations
- More focused on individual slide graphics than multi-chapter corporate reports
